WHAT IS A CYCLONE?

⇒A Cyclone is a large scale air mass that rotates around strong centers of low pressure.

HOW IS A CYCLONE FORMED?

☠️Water vapors are formed when water is heated.

☠️This heat is released to atmosphere when water vapors convert to water during rains.

☠️The heat released, warms the air around and makes it to move up. This also results in decreased air pressure.

☠️Hence, cooler air from surrounding rushes to take the warm air’s place.

☠️This repeats till a low pressure system with surrounding high speed winds is created. This is called a Cyclone.

☠️Cyclone depends on wind speed, direction, temperature and humidity.

EXTRA INFORMATION

Cyclones are also called Hurricane in USA and Typhoon in Japan and Philippines
